Understanding Patient Assignment in Clinical Trials
Managing patient assignment is crucial for the integrity of any clinical trial. It involves ensuring that participants are allocated to specific treatment groups correctly and randomly. This randomization is significant because it helps eliminate bias, making the results more reliable.
